Rotational Stability of Different Intraocular Lenses in The Capsular Bag

To evaluate the rotational stability difference among different intraocular lens. The rotational stability is evaluated by measurement of rotation of the IOL after surgery.

Inclusion criteria

  • Age ≥ 18 years
  • Patients who had received Femtosecond laser-assisted phacoemulsification surgery with IntelliAxis-L capsular mark.
  • The operation was smooth and there were no surgical complications.

Exclusion criteria

  • Corneal and other ocular diseases (such as corneal opacity, keratitis, glaucoma, uveitis, lens dislocation or subluxation, lens capsule relaxation, retinopathy, etc.);
  • History of ocular trauma or surgery before this cataract surgery;
  • intraoperative and postoperative complications, such as posterior capsule rupture, corneal endothelium decompensation;
  • Patients with severe or unstable heart, liver, kidney, lung, endocrine (including thyroid dysfunction), blood, mental dysfunction and other diseases affect the results of this study;
